How the Most Accurate Weather App Delivers Real Value
At its core, accuracy in weather apps comes from three key elements: data quality, predictive modeling, and user-specific customization. The leading apps integrate real-time data from global satellite systems, ground-based weather stations, and advanced atmospheric models. This fusion allows them to detect shifts moments before they happen, offering hyperlocal details like precipitation timing, wind gusts, or UV levels with remarkable precision. Machine learning continuously fine-tunes predictions by comparing forecasts to actual outcomes, improving reliability day after day.
